Structure actuelle du reseau

From Bubble

Contents

Address Plan

Besoins

Voici les differents besoins identifiés:

  • Configuration aisée des clients. (DHCP)
  • Reseau de management comprenant tout les noeuds principaux.
  • Petits sous-réseaux permettant l'interconnexion et le routage aisé de deux nodes ou plus.
  • Pouvoir facilement interconnecter deux nodes via une connexion filaire afin de consommer moins de bande passante sans fil. (Interconnexion de deux nodes)
  • DNS dans le réseau citoyen ? (preconisation de r-c.be pour le DNS interne, c'est plus court que reseaucitoyen.be :p)

Terminologie

  • Management Network: Réseau composé uniquement des équipements réseaux (WRT, Routeurs, ...).
  • Node Network: Réseau associé a une node en particulier, plus la node est populaire, plus le réseau sera grand. (/28, /27, /24)
  • Peering Network: Réseau sous découpé en petit réseaux pouvant être réservés au cas par cas pour l'interconnexion et le routage aisé de deux nodes ou plus.

Concrêtement

Concrêtement, le réseau général de la ville (/16) sera composé d'une part d'un réseau moyen (/24) dédié a l'administration des équipements réseaux et d'autre part de petit sous-réseaux (/24, /27) découpés en fonction de la popularité et de l'importance du noeud sur lequel il sera utilisé.

Dans chaque "Access Network", un server DHCP pourra être mis en place par le mainteneur de ce noeud. Toutefois, on veillera a n'utiliser qu'un serveur DHCP par réseau. Par convention, on installera celui-ci sur la dernière IP disponible du réseau concerné. (souvent .254)

Aucun DHCP ne sera présent dans le Management Network et la réservation des ip de celui-ci s'effectuera via une page wiki référencée sur cette même page.

Avec cette segmentation, l'ajout d'un DNS global et hierarchique peut être facilement envisagé:

  • lg.r-c.be: dns principal de liège.
    • kennedy.lg.r-c.be: noeud kennedy.
    • longdoz.lg.r-c.be: noeud longdoz.
    • etc...
  • De la même manière un reverse dns est envisageable...
  • Une décentralisation maximale de ces DNS est a prévoir...

Pratique

Les sous-reseaux

ReseauCitoyen 10.91.0.0/16 /27 Peerings (Routing)? FUTUR

ReseauCitoyen 10.93.0.0/16 /27 Omnis (Usage) UTILISE

ReseauCitoyen 10.94.0.0/16 /27 Omnis (Usage) FUTUR

ReseauCitoyen 10.95.0.0/16 /27 Omnis (Usage) FUTUR

Detached 10.97.0.0/16 /24 http://www.detached.be joris@linux.be Stefan:Doesn't exist anymore

WirelessAntwerpen 10.98.0.0/16 /24 http://www.wirelessantwerpen.be info@wirelessantwerpen.be

WirelessCity 10.99.0.0/16 /24 http://www.wireless-city.be info@wireless-city.be

Les IPs

( Voir pour merger ici la page: RCF )

il est bien sur logique de completer cette page avant de migrer et non après

Bruxelles,Brussel

  • 10.93.0.0/16 Brussels' main network.

Pour les OMNI channel1 essid bombolong un /22 devrait suffire en attendant

dans un second temps il serait envisageable d' utiliser des outils comme avahi,apipa,zeroconf,bonjour,...
on en discutera.
Il serait mieux de mettre les omnis dans une /22 allouee a la fin de la /16 de ReseauCitoyen:
Netmask:   255.255.252.0 = 22
Network:   10.93.252.0/22       !00001010.01011101.111111 00.00000000
HostMin:   10.93.252.1          !00001010.01011101.111111 00.00000001
HostMax:   10.93.255.254        !00001010.01011101.111111 11.11111110
Broadcast: 10.93.255.255        !00001010.01011101.111111 11.11111111
Hosts/Net: 1022                  Class A, Private Internet


Configuration actuelle très très très temporaire/instable ... : à corriger au fur et à mesure des changements svp :

    • 10.93.1.0/24 channel1 essid bombolong (G Omni).
      • 10.93.1.1 josaphat Omni 2.4
      • 10.93.252.2 PeTv connecte a la rue de molenbeek newreal amalia
      • 10.93.252.3 Atelier ( rue de molenbeek ) mac:00:0f:66:c8:ac:c8
      • 10.93.1.4 Matinal
      • 10.93.252.5 Amalia
      • 10.93.1.6 Newreal
      • 10.93.1.7 atelier-bis
      • 10.93.1.8 Newreal bis
      • 10.93.1.9 ChienVert
      • 10.93.252.10 LaekenStation mac:00:16:b6:d9:44:61
      • 10.93.252.11 Olme
      • 10.93.1.12 botatv ( Boulevard Saint Lazarre 1210 Saint Josse | rubber duck 7dbi)
      • 10.93.1.13 denswrt
      • 10.93.1.14 panik mac:06:18:84:19:3B:95 lan:192.168.1.14 (f0n)
      • 10.93.1.15 bossuet
      • 10.93.1.16 ivan
      • 10.93.1.17 madou
      • 10.93.1.18 ministere
      • 10.93.1.19 okno mac:00:02:6f:36:8e:82
      • 10.93.1.20 pointdom
      • 10.93.1.21 philantropie
      • 10.93.1.22 bulles
      • 10.93.1.23 so-on (A.M.)
      • 10.93.1.24 svenontheroof
      • 10.93.1.25 svenwrt
      • 10.93.1.26 wlhdd (travelnode)
      • 10.93.1.27 wl500g
      • 10.93.1.28 aumale
      • 10.93.1.29 ruedemerode
      • 10.93.1.30 fontainas
      • 10.93.1.31 imke
      • 10.93.1.32 imke2
      • 10.93.1.33 botatv2 (omni 7dbi + usb)
      • 10.93.1.34 leysin
      • 10.93.1.35 hotel
      • 10.93.1.36 sourcenode
      • 10.93.1.37 clementine
      • 10.93.1.38 Morgiver
      • 10.93.1.39 bombofon39
      • 10.93.1.40 bombofon40
      • 10.93.1.41 oldRCwrtFirmware
      • 10.93.1.42 inconnumais dans les routes
      • 10.93.1.43 desmeth
      • 10.93.1.44 washington
      • 10.93.1.45 philT
      • 10.93.1.46 bombofon46OK
      • 10.93.1.47 bombofon47OK
      • 10.93.1.48 bombofon48OK
      • 10.93.1.49 bombofon49OK
      • 10.93.1.50 bombofon50OK
      • 10.93.1.51 bombofon51OK
      • 10.93.1.52 bombofon52OK
      • 10.93.1.53 bombofon53OK
      • 10.93.1.54 ViaducV2
      • 10.93.1.55 botafon
      • 10.93.1.56 hottat
      • 10.93.252.57 cheypas-bombolong
      • 10.93.1.58 samuxl
      • 10.93.1.59 noone
      • 10.93.1.60 Batman
      • 10.93.1.61 SaidD-point_back
      • 10.93.1.62 SaidD-point_back02
      • 10.93.1.63 SaidD-point_back03
      • 10.93.1.64 SaidD-wrt
      • 10.93.1.65 fonerapotagere mac:
      • 10.93.1.66 Pbook
      • 10.93.1.67 WAP54G
      • 10.93.1.68 manoubombolong
      • 10.93.1.69 fon7.09test
      • 10.93.1.70 wrtrctester mac:
      • 10.93.1.71 wrtsanslan mac:00:0F:66:A0:F9:57
      • 10.93.1.72 elisa
      • 10.93.1.73 interface3 mac:00:14:BF:C4:EF:27
      • 10.93.1.74 radiophonics'brigitinnesnodes'
      • 10.93.1.75 limite
      • 10.93.1.76 minfin
      • 10.93.1.77 haltebus
      • 10.93.1.78 potagerad-hocwrt mac: 00:14:BF:C4:D1:45
      • 10.93.1.79 lahaag-flyonthewall
      • 10.93.1.80 berthelot ( forest )
      • 10.93.1.81 wlhmd-cam1 (okno)
      • 10.93.1.82 wlhmd-cam2 (okno)
      • 10.93.1.83 wlhmd-ard1 (okno)
      • 10.93.1.84 wlhmd-ezstream (okno)
      • 10.93.1.85 wlhmd (okno)
      • 10.93.1.86 wlhmd (okno)
      • 10.93.1.87 lahaag-2
      • 10.93.1.88 PEL46
      • 10.93.1.89 wlhmd-89 (okno)
      • 10.93.1.90 wlhmd-90 (okno)
      • 10.93.1.91 wlhmd-91 (okno)
      • 10.93.1.92 side-laptop
      • 10.93.1.93 edwin
      • 10.93.1.94 Olli
      • 10.93.1.95 pouleNoire
      • 10.93.1.96 newWRT
      • 10.93.1.97 wlhmd-97 (okno)
      • 10.93.1.98 wlhmd-98 (okno)
      • 10.93.1.99 wlhmd-99 (okno)
      • 10.93.1.100 aGS
      • 10.93.1.101 Juego
      • 10.93.1.102 Juego
      • 10.93.1.103 InstitutStJoseph
      • 10.93.1.104 ERG1
      • 10.93.1.105 ERG2
      • 10.93.1.106 ERG3
      • 10.93.1.107 bowrt


      • 10.93.1.111 Okno-in


      • 10.93.1.124 SvenPhone


      • 10.93.1.145 philTmobile

Pour les renfort en 5ghz et 2.4ghz

    • 10.93.0.0/27 Cheypas
      • 10.93.0.2 chokotoff
      • 10.93.0.3 petv2cheypas
    • 10.93.0.32/27 PeTv
      • 10.93.0.33 petvwepch11
      • 10.93.0.34 rmolenwepch11
      • 10.93.0.35 Cheypas (G Yagi)
    • 10.93.0.64/27 Rmolen lan inter-nodes
      • 10.93.0.65 Rmolen5g-lan
      • 10.93.0.66 Rmolench1-lan
      • 10.93.0.67 Rmolench1bis-lan
      • 10.93.0.68 rmolench11-lan
      • 10.93.0.69 sipcli-lan
      • 10.93.0.70 sip2cli-lan
      • 10.93.0.71 bombofon39lan
      • 10.93.0.72 bmobofon40lan
      • 10.93.0.73 rttserverasterisk
    • 10.93.0.96/27 5ghz josaphatmaster (Netmask: 255.255.255.224, Broadcast: 10.93.0.127)
      • 10.93.0.97 5ghz josaphatmaster
      • 10.93.0.98 5ghz rmolen
      • 10.93.0.99 5ghz madou
      • 10.93.0.100 5ghz chazal
      • 10.93.0.101 5ghz okno
      • 10.93.0.102 5ghz amalia
      • 10.93.0.103 5ghz cheypas5g
      • 10.93.0.112 5ghz cheypaspasasage (il a pas respecté la regle ououou)
    • 10.93.0.128/27 pointdomlan
      • 10.93.0.129 pointdomchan1lan
      • 10.93.0.130 pointdomchan11lan
    • 10.93.0.160/27 lan amalia
      • 10.93.0.161 lan-2.4ghz
      • 10.93.0.162 lan-5ghz
    • 10.93.0.192/27 rmolen5gtest
      • 10.93.0.193
    • 10.93.0.224/28 potagere
      • 10.93.0.225 antenne
      • 10.93.0.226 sipclient
    • 10.93.0.240/28 ministere
      • 10.93.0.241 antenne
      • 10.93.0.242 sipserver
      • 10.93.0.243 sipclient

!!!un trou dans les addresse en attendant que le channel1 passe en .252.0/22

    • 10.93.2.0/28 josaphatlan
      • 10.93.2.1 josaphat lan5ghz
      • 10.93.2.2 josaphat lan2.4ghz
    • 10.93.2.16/28 petvV2lan
      • 10.93.2.17 lanch1
      • 10.93.2.18 lanch11
    • 10.93.2.32/28 oknomaster
      • 10.93.2.33 oknomaster
      • 10.93.2.34 madouclient
    • 10.93.2.48/28 oknoinfra
      • 10.93.2.49 soekris
      • 10.93.2.50 minisoekris
    • 10.93.2.64/29 brusiServices
      • 10.93.2.65 serv
      • 10.93.2.69 wrt
      • 10.93.2.70 5giga
    • 10.93.2.72/29 potagereintermode
      • 10.93.2.73 wrtwan
      • 10.93.2.74 foneralan mac:00:18:84:27:87:54
    • 10.93.2.80/29
      • 10.93.2.81 wrtrtt11
      • 10.93.2.82 sipserver
    • 10.93.2.88/29
      • 10.93.2.89 lan soekrismadou
      • 10.93.2.90 wan wrt madou
    • 10.93.2.96/28
      • 10.93.2.97 lan wrtMaPoule
      • 10.93.2.98 sip device

Liège, Luik

wirelessAntwerpen

  • 10.98.0.0/16: Main WirelessAntwerpen Network.
    • Client omni's, each 2.4 ghz omni has a /24 subnet and .100 to .254 dhcp scope
    • 10.98.1.0/24: Schoten
    • 10.98.2.0/24: Borgerhout-Oost Omni1
    • 10.98.3.0/24: Deurne-Sportpaleis
    • 10.98.4.0/24: Hoboken
    • 10.98.5.0/24: Borgerhout-Oost Omni2
    • 10.98.6.0/24: Wilrijk
    • 10.98.7.0/24: Antwerpen-Stadspark
    • 10.98.8.0/24: Borgerhout-Horizon
    • 10.98.9.0/24: Borgerhout-Frostfire
    • 10.98.10.0/24: Heist o/d Berg
    • 10.98.11.0/24: Diest
    • 10.98.12.0/24: Deurne
    • 10.98.13.0/24: Borgerhout-Bacchus
    • 10.98.14.0/24: Antwerpen-Linker
    • 10.98.15.0/24: HOB Services
    • 10.98.16.0/24: Berchem
    • 10.98.17.0/24: Wilrijk-Permeke
    • 10.98.18.0/24: Antwerpen-Stadspark2
    • 10.98.19.0/24: Melsele
    • 10.98.20.0/24: Westerlo
    • 10.98.21.0/24: Atomium/protocol
    • 10.98.22.0/24: Atomium/protocol
    • 10.98.23.0/24: Lier
    • 10.98.24.0/24: SPL
    • 10.98.25.0/24: Berchem2
    • 10.98.26.0/24: Antwerpen-Justitie
    • 10.98.27.0/24: Antwerpen / ijzerlaan
    • 10.98.28.0/24: Mortsel
    • 10.98.29.0/24: Tielt-winge
    • 10.98.30.0/24: Schilde
    • 10.98.32.0/24: Beerzel
    • 10.98.33.0/24: Tongeren (Vreren)
    • 10.98.34.0/24: Tongeren2
    • 10.98.35.0/24: Lille
    • 10.98.36.0/24: St Truiden
    • 10.98.38.0/24: Herentals
    • 10.98.39.0/24: Ufsia
    • 10.98.41.0/24: Antwerpen-Eilandje
    • 10.98.100.0/24: Schoten
    • 10.98.101.0/28: Schoten-VPN
    • 10.98.150.0/24: Hasselt (rapertingen)
    • 10.98.151.0/24: Hasselt-Kanaal
    • 10.98.153.0/24: Hasselt (grensland)
    • 10.98.152.0/24: Hasselt (grensland)
    • 10.98.154.0/24: Hasselt-Ethias
  • 5 ghz point to point links with 10.98.255.0/30 subnets
    • Examples:
    • Schoten <=> Oost 10.98.255.9 and 10.98.255.10
    • Oost <=> Berchem 10.98.255.21 and 10.98.255.22
    • Oost <=> Deurne 10.98.255.25 and 10.98.255.26
  • Ethernet subnets for local access at a node with 10.98.253.0/28 subnets
    • Examples:
    • Oost 10.98.253.0/28
    • Lier 10.98.253.16/28
    • Heist o/d Berg 10.98.253.32/28

Outils

Memo

Les mouhs peuvent utiliser l'outil "ipcalc" qui vient en paquet sur la majorité des distributions linux et qui donne un truc du genre:


 # ipcalc 10.93.0.1/28
 Address:   10.93.0.1            !00001010.01011101.00000000.0000 0001
 Netmask:   255.255.255.240 = 28 !11111111.11111111.11111111.1111 0000
 Wildcard:  0.0.0.15             !00000000.00000000.00000000.0000 1111
 =>
 Network:   10.93.0.0/28         !00001010.01011101.00000000.0000 0000
 HostMin:   10.93.0.1            !00001010.01011101.00000000.0000 0001
 HostMax:   10.93.0.14           !00001010.01011101.00000000.0000 1110
 Broadcast: 10.93.0.15           !00001010.01011101.00000000.0000 1111
 Hosts/Net: 14                    Class A, Private Internet


/28 veut dire que 28 bits de l'adresse IP seront utilisés pour s'addresser au sous-réseau, les 3 bits suivant serviront a s'adresser aux machines (qui ont chacune une adresse IP) et le dernier bit servira de broadcast.

Par exemple le sous-réseau 10.93.0.0 peut contenir des adresses IP de 10.93.0.1 a 10.93.0.14, 10.93.0.15 étant le broadcast, le sous-réseau suivant en /28 est 10.93.0.16, qui peut contenir les adresses IP de 10.93.0.17 a 10.93.0.30, .31 est le broadcast et .32 le sous-réseau suivant.